In some parts of Africa, kids were forbidden to eat eggs! It is assumed that kids that starts eating eggs early will have the tendency to pilfer or steal in their future. How our parents came up with this unscientific conclusion is still a mystery. Egg is one of the cheapest protein and it should be given to kids and in many quantities. . It is an egg. World Egg Day is a unique opportunity to help raise awareness of the benefits of eggs and is celebrated in countries all around the world.World Egg Day was established at the IEC Vienna 1996 conference when it was decided to celebrate World Egg Day on the second Friday in October each year.

Egg is a very good and cheap protein, though here in Nigeria people tend to stay away from egg due to some “medical” reasons by their “doctors.” It has been advised that children should consume more of the eggs. The nutritional benefits of eggs are numerous.


Well… eggs are an excellent source of protein, with a single large egg containing 6 grams.Eggs contain all the essential amino acids in the right ratios, so our bodies are well equipped to make full use of the protein in them.Eating adequate protein can help with weight loss, increase muscle mass, lower blood pressure and optimize bone health… to name a few


A single large boiled egg contains :
Vitamin A: 6% of the RDA.
Folate: 5% of the RDA.
Vitamin B5: 7% of the RDA.
Vitamin B12: 9% of the RDA.
Vitamin B2: 15% of the RDA.
Phosphorus: 9% of the RDA.
Selenium: 22% of the RDA.


Eggs also contain decent amounts of Vitamin D, Vitamin E, Vitamin K, Vitamin B6, Calcium and Zinc. This is coming with 77 calories, 6 grams of protein and 5 grams of healthy fats.Eggs also contain various other trace nutrients that are important for health.Really, eggs are pretty much the perfect food, they contain a little bit of almost every nutrient we need.
